For the 2025 school year, there are 13 public schools serving 10,158 students in 78681, TX (there are , serving 822 private students). 93% of all K-12 students in 78681, TX are educated in public schools (compared to the TX state average of 94%).
The top ranked public schools in 78681, TX are Cactus Ranch Elementary School, Great Oaks Elementary School and James Garland Walsh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public schools in zipcode 78681 have an average math proficiency score of 72% (versus the Texas public school average of 44%), and reading proficiency score of 72% (versus the 51% statewide average). Schools in 78681, TX have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 5% of Texas public schools.
Minority enrollment is 60%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is less than the Texas public school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).
